‘I FELL TO THE FLOOR’

Bartender receives $1,000 tip at Liberty Place Pub in Kennett Square

Katie Horisk received an unexpected surprise this May.

On May 10, two patrons stopped by Liberty Place Pub for a drink. The husband-and-wife couple ended up leaving Horisk with a $1,000 tip on a $41 tab.

“I fell to the floor,” Horisk said upon seeing the tip.

Horisk said Wednesday that she’d never seen the couple before their visit at Liberty Place Pub, which is located in downtown Kennett Square at The Market at Liberty Place, 148 W. State St.

Horisk, 32, said the couple didn’t give a reason for the extremely generous tip. She resides in New Castle, Delaware, and began working at Liberty Place Pub in 2019. “I’m a new mom,” said Horisk. Her son, Finley, turns 1 on June 7 and she said the money will come in handy.

“I got him a few birthday presents,” Horisk said of how she spent some of the tip money.

“How incredible it was to see that someone left a $1,000 tip for Katie,” said James Miller, coowner and manager of Liberty Place Pub. “I heard of big tippers, but this one takes the cake. A huge shoutout to the anonymous patrons.”

Liberty Place Pub is open seven days a week. The bar features an array of cocktail options and 16 draft beers on tap.

The tip comes as the restaurant industry battles to overcome huge losses sustained by the pandemic.

U.S. Senators were set to vote Thursday on a $48 billion small-business aid bill to help restaurant­s and select other industries that suffered revenue losses during the pandemic. The main goal of the bill is to backfill the Restaurant Revitaliza­tion Fund with $40 billion for the roughly two-thirds of applicants who didn’t receive any grant money under the initial $28.6 billion program.
